Convert ACDT to JST
JST is 1 hour 30 minutes behind ACDT. ACDT is UTC+10:30 and JST is UTC+9.

Best time to schedule a meeting
Standard 9–5 working hours overlap for 6 hours: 11:00 AM–5:00 PM ACDT (9:00 AM–3:00 PM JST). Schedule meetings inside that window.

About ACDT
Australian Central Daylight Time (ACDT) is UTC+10:30. It is used in Adelaide in summer.
Australian Central Daylight Time is UTC+10:30, what South Australia keeps from October to April. Darwin stays on ACST through the summer, so for those months two cities in the same nominal zone are an hour apart — the only reason to be precise about which of the two abbreviations a meeting invitation carries.
About JST
Japan Standard Time (JST) is UTC+9. It is used in all of Japan, with no daylight saving.
Japan Standard Time is UTC+9 for the whole country and has had no daylight saving since 1951, when the occupation-era experiment was abandoned. Proposals to reintroduce it, most recently before the 2020 Olympics, have failed each time. The offset is shared with South Korea, so Tokyo and Seoul never differ by even a minute.
Does this gap change with the seasons?
Neither ACDT nor JST shifts with the seasons, so this 1.5-hour difference holds all year. That is unusual enough to be worth relying on: most cross-continental gaps move twice a year.
This is the reason scheduling systems store an IANA zone such as Region/City rather than an offset or an abbreviation: the zone knows its own rules and the offset does not.
